Insurance Program Delivery Specialist

Remote Full-time
About the position

The Insurance Program Delivery Specialist is responsible for executing insurance product and service delivery activities, coordinating the processing efforts of extended team members, and providing high-quality client support. This role involves handling small to mid-sized global accounts of moderate complexity, requiring technical knowledge of systems and procedures, under supervision. The specialist constructs basic insurance policy contracts and invoices, assists team members to ensure timely processing, and maintains client and broker contact information.
